Cooperative Research Information System Objective

 

  • Identify the genetic mechanisms associated with the development and maintenance of AR and develop rapid tests to identify resistance genes.
  • Determining the in vivo (particularly in poultry) and in vitro effect the acquisition of resistance confers on the bacterium.
  • Conduct prospective ecological studies to better define the acquisition, transmission, and dissemination of AR including, as a component, participation in the National Antimicrobial Resistance Monitoring System (NARMS).
